Replacing your roof involves several variables that shift your final bill. The total square footage of your property is the biggest factor, followed closely by the pitch or steepness of your roof, which dictates how safely crews can work. You will also need to choose your materials—architectural shingles, metal, or tile each carry different price points. We also have to account for the removal and disposal of your current roof, plus the condition of the underlying wood decking that might need repairs once the old shingles are off. Metal roof panels are large, factory-formed sections installed vertically or horizontally to create a clean, modern look. They are ideal for homeowners who want a sleek appearance and a system that stands up well to fire and wind. These panels are typically installed using hidden fasteners to minimize leaks. Corrugated metal roofing is a popular choice in Portland due to its durability and cost-effectiveness. The ribbed design provides structural strength, making it resistant to wind and impact from debris common in our area. It's also lightweight, which can be an advantage for some roof structures. Polycarbonate roof panels can be used in Portland for specific applications, often for sheds, patios, or skylights, rather than primary residential roofing. They offer good light transmission and impact resistance. However, for full roof coverage, metal panels are generally preferred for their superior longevity and weatherproofing capabilities in Portland's climate. Metal roofs offer several advantages over asphalt shingles in Portland. They are significantly more durable, with a lifespan often exceeding 30-50 years compared to asphalt's 15-30 years. Metal is also more resistant to fire, wind, and hail. While asphalt shingles can be damaged by moss growth common in our climate, metal roofs are less susceptible. Roof insulation is material installed in the attic or under the roof deck to regulate indoor temperature. In Portland, good insulation is crucial for both keeping homes cool in the summer and warm in the winter. It helps reduce energy consumption and makes your home more comfortable. Installing a new roof in Portland typically begins with removing the old roofing material. The existing roof deck is then inspected for any damage and repaired if necessary. Next, underlayment is applied, followed by the installation of the chosen metal roof panels. Pros ensure proper flashing around vents, chimneys, and edges to prevent leaks. Clay roof tiles offer a distinctive aesthetic and excellent durability, making them a long-lasting option. They are naturally fire-resistant and can withstand various weather conditions. However, clay tiles are significantly heavier than metal panels and can be more prone to breakage from heavy impact.
